Output 3933b3991579b30284161c7b26fe44256c8e3897c2d554f04ff9d55335d82206:0

value
2601935142
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dfefcf3089535463d68004927be8895d376c0dcb OP_EQUAL
address
3N75tZpHb5HrgagEUM2X3UDt11fo2vqeLQ
transaction
3933b3991579b30284161c7b26fe44256c8e3897c2d554f04ff9d55335d82206
confirmations
250878
spent
true